class Environment(object):
"""
Tensorforce environment interface.
"""
[docs] @staticmethod
def create(
environment=None, max_episode_timesteps=None, remote=None, blocking=False, host=None,
port=None, **kwargs
):
"""
Creates an environment from a specification. In case of "socket-server" remote mode, runs
environment in server communication loop until closed.
Args:
environment (specification | Environment class/object): JSON file, specification key,
configuration dictionary, library module, `Environment` class/object, or gym.Env
(<span style="color:#C00000"><b>required</b>, invalid for "socket-client" remote
mode</span>).
max_episode_timesteps (int > 0): Maximum number of timesteps per episode, overwrites
the environment default if defined
(<span style="color:#00C000"><b>default</b></span>: environment default, invalid
for "socket-client" remote mode).
remote ("multiprocessing" | "socket-client" | "socket-server"): Communication mode for
remote environment execution of parallelized environment execution, "socket-client"
mode requires a corresponding "socket-server" running, and "socket-server" mode
runs environment in server communication loop until closed
(<span style="color:#00C000"><b>default</b></span>: local execution).
blocking (bool): Whether remote environment calls should be blocking
(<span style="color:#00C000"><b>default</b></span>: not blocking, invalid unless
"multiprocessing" or "socket-client" remote mode).
host (str): Socket server hostname or IP address
(<span style="color:#C00000"><b>required</b></span> only for "socket-client" remote
mode).
port (int): Socket server port
(<span style="color:#C00000"><b>required</b></span> only for "socket-client/server"
remote mode).
kwargs: Additional arguments.
"""

[docs] def states(self):
"""
Returns the state space specification.
Returns:
specification: Arbitrarily nested dictionary of state descriptions with the following
attributes:
<ul>
<li><b>type</b> (<i>"bool" | "int" | "float"</i>) – state data type
(<span style="color:#00C000"><b>default</b></span>: "float").</li>
<li><b>shape</b> (<i>int | iter[int]</i>) – state shape
(<span style="color:#C00000"><b>required</b></span>).</li>
<li><b>num_states</b> (<i>int > 0</i>) – number of discrete state values
(<span style="color:#C00000"><b>required</b></span> for type "int").</li>
<li><b>min_value/max_value</b> (<i>float</i>) – minimum/maximum state value
(<span style="color:#00C000"><b>optional</b></span> for type "float").</li>
</ul>
"""
raise NotImplementedError
[docs] def actions(self):
"""
Returns the action space specification.
Returns:
specification: Arbitrarily nested dictionary of action descriptions with the following
attributes:
<ul>
<li><b>type</b> (<i>"bool" | "int" | "float"</i>) – action data type
(<span style="color:#C00000"><b>required</b></span>).</li>
<li><b>shape</b> (<i>int > 0 | iter[int > 0]</i>) – action shape
(<span style="color:#00C000"><b>default</b></span>: scalar).</li>
<li><b>num_actions</b> (<i>int > 0</i>) – number of discrete action values
(<span style="color:#C00000"><b>required</b></span> for type "int").</li>
<li><b>min_value/max_value</b> (<i>float</i>) – minimum/maximum action value
(<span style="color:#00C000"><b>optional</b></span> for type "float").</li>
</ul>
"""
raise NotImplementedError
[docs] def max_episode_timesteps(self):
"""
Returns the maximum number of timesteps per episode.
Returns:
int: Maximum number of timesteps per episode.
"""
return self._max_episode_timesteps
[docs] def close(self):
"""
Closes the environment.
"""
pass
[docs] def reset(self):
"""
Resets the environment to start a new episode.
Returns:
dict[state]: Dictionary containing initial state(s) and auxiliary information.
"""
raise NotImplementedError
[docs] def execute(self, actions):
"""
Executes the given action(s) and advances the environment by one step.
Args:
actions (dict[action]): Dictionary containing action(s) to be executed
(<span style="color:#C00000"><b>required</b></span>).
Returns:
dict[state], bool | 0 | 1 | 2, float: Dictionary containing next state(s), whether
a terminal state is reached or 2 if the episode was aborted, and observed reward.
"""
raise NotImplementedError
